Показать сообщение отдельно
Старый 18.11.2016, 02:44   #712
Angels13
Пользователь
 
Аватар для Angels13
 
Регистрация: 27.07.2013
Возраст: 37
Город: Redditch(UK)
Регион: другой - для добавления сообщить ab
Машина: Mazda 6 IIgen
Сообщений: 39
Angels13 will become famous soon enoughAngels13 will become famous soon enough
По умолчанию

И так через дикую (_!_) я решил свой вопрос. Сразу скажу нужен рут.
Как получить функцию BACK. У меня напомню не работал ESC в IGo. Нужен был именно BACK. Нужен любой файловый менеджер с рут доступом. Я пользуюсь RootExplorer. Далее идем в корневую папку: system/usr/keylayout/generic.kl - открываем при помощи текстого редактора. И меняем F1 на BACK. Так же я поменял F2 на SEARCH.
Далее вставляем в свой скетч:
PHP код:
if (data==848) { Keyboard.write(194); delay (300);}
  if (
data==2)
  {   
Keyboard.press(195);   
Keyboard.press(97);
Keyboard.releaseAll();
delay (300);   

Где data значение кнопки. 194 - это arduino F1 - тем самым получается arduino посылает сигнал F1 а планшет его понимает как BACK. И все прекрасно работает

Со вторым тоже просто. Как было сказано ранее на форуме ставите прогу HW Key Quicksettings Launcher там просто жмете на сочетание и выбираете прогу которая вам нужна на быстрый запуск при этом сочетании. Как мы помним SEARCH у наснастроен на F2. И все простенький код - нажать F2 - нажать букву - отпустить все. Я поставил запуск навигации.

P.S. Думаю что c командой Remote.search - такого не выйдет так как это не клавиша а команда - поиск в интернете.
Angels13 вне форума   Ответить с цитированием